Vegetables, in particular potatoes, are becoming cheaper in Ukraine, and fruits are mostly becoming more expensive

Cucumbers, potatoes and onions fell in price, while apples and pears rose in price. This is reported by EastFruit. Bulk prices for onions currently start at UAH 10, not UAH 13, as a week ago. The situation is the same with potatoes - the lower price limit fell from UAH 22 to UAH 20. In addition, for the first time in a month and a half, cucumbers became cheaper. The vegetable is sold for UAH 90-110/kg, although a week earlier it cost UAH 100-125/kg. Participants sold pumpkin cheaper than a week earlier - UAH 15-10/kg, although a week earlier wholesale prices were at the level of UAH 17-25/kg. Chinese cabbage rose in price from UAH 30-35 to UAH 38-40/kg, and cauliflower decreased in price from UAH 90-110 to UAH 70-100/kg. In the segment of greens, the prices of dill decreased - from UAH 120-170 to UAH 100-150/kg, and lettuce - from UAH 50-110 to UAH 40-80/kg.
